Ine Posted May 29, 2022 #6 Share Posted May 29, 2022 (edited) Yes certainly walkable. Be aware tickets to AF house are only for sale online, no more standing in line. Sales starts on the 1st Tuesday of a month for the next month. Tickets sell very fast! Details on their website: https://www.annefrank.org/en/museum/tickets/ Edited May 29, 2022 by Ine 2 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Dutch_Travelgirl Posted June 23, 2022 #14 Share Posted June 23, 2022 The tickets are usually released sometime in the morning, Amsterdam local time. Some people have reported that they could buy tickets the day before the first Tuesday of the month but that could have been a one time glitch.
